From the idea to the end product, the process of developing a mobile application is one that calls for different devices and software too creativity and also innovation. The work that enters into every phase of this procedure has actually boosted in time provided the multitude of mobile applications being established. Mobile application programmers can no longer collaborate with any concept they desire to and also have to take into consideration several aspects when establishing a mobile app.

Idea Proofing
Before you start developing your application, it is necessary to think about all elements of your idea. What feels like a brilliant and cutting-edge concept to you may have currently been become an application by an internet application growth firm. It is therefore much better to research the marketplace as well as applications that resemble your principle and take into consideration how your application will be various as well as special, Get more info.

An essential factor of concept proofing is functionality. A mobile application growth firm will certainly take a look at beginning little and also perfecting the major use of the application. Mobile application programmers can later on include attributes to the application to boost functionality.

An additional aspect to consider is if the application solves individual problems. Your principle for an application will certainly be based on an issue or demand of target individuals. Nevertheless, does your application actually supply remedies to this issue or meet user needs? Giving thought to this aspect of your application will certainly aid you create one that individuals have an usage for.

In regards to target audience, it is important to the success of the application that you do the required research study before taking your principle to a software program growth business.

Mobile Platforms and also Data Source
You may know that there are two major types of applications; iphone and Android. Developing an app for just one system will certainly exclude a significant section of your target audience as well as a mobile application advancement company will motivate making the app accessible on these 2 main platforms.

For this, you can utilize cross-platform structures to guarantee your app is compatible on both iOS as well as Android. When picking a cross-platform structure, contrast the software program with the greatest rankings and inspect if the features suit your requirements. You can likewise collaborate with a software advancement company like Codelantic to guarantee the end item is specifically what you want it to be.

One point to remember is that consistency is vital. Similar symbols and aspects throughout platforms will certainly make it much easier for users to recognize your application. Consistency will certainly additionally make your application look even more expert.

In addition to mobile platforms, you have to likewise think about the database you intend to utilize. A quick data source is necessary to mobile app development and a few aspects to consider are information structure, rate, scalability, and ease of access and also safety of information.

Aesthetic Layout
Despite how great and one-of-a-kind your principle is, your application may have very few individuals if you do not deal with innovative as well as proficient mobile app developers who will consider user interface as well as individual experience when creating the app.

If the design of your app is not aesthetically pleasing, users may consider alternate applications even if your app has even more functions. This is why it is essential that you concentrate on the style of your app. One of the factors to keep in mind is that your material is your interface, which means that you need to remove any unnecessary components.

Utilizing a solitary input area is additionally something a web application advancement firm like Moxly would recommend as it adversely influences user experience. What you need to do is develop a conversation flow to ensure that users really feel comfortable using your app.

A software program growth business will certainly likewise advise against excessive using push notifications and also other attributes that will certainly make customers uninstall the application as well as provide it low ratings.

Scalability
Finally, consider what you desire your application to be in the future. Exists room to make changes to the application to ensure that it does not turn into an outdated idea? Talk with your internet application development firm regarding the scalability of the application when creating it and also what adjustments may be needed in the future, Web site.
There are no comments on this page.
Valid XHTML :: Valid CSS: :: Powered by WikkaWiki